Output 21ae2d5c5386c1faa0d0eb49553678b44aa88e0c7a1310ea0eab90081400c476:82

value
97354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7455381d7e0262f5217078ab2b5fec59e7dc0a76 OP_EQUAL
address
3CJ8PvtT6EWBfYMg1w8kVcnzBDdViztrT4
transaction
21ae2d5c5386c1faa0d0eb49553678b44aa88e0c7a1310ea0eab90081400c476
spent
true